What typical tasks or challenges can I expect when using VLOOKUP in an Excel-based data analyst role?

In an Excel-based data analyst position, you'll frequently use VLOOKUP to combine and match data from multiple sources. Common challenges include handling errors when lookup values are missing, ensuring data consistency (such as matching formats), and managing large datasets where VLOOKUP performance can slow down. You'll also collaborate with team members to validate results and may need to troubleshoot or optimize formulas to ensure accurate reporting. Mastering these tasks is key to providing timely and reliable data insights for your team.

What is the difference between Excel Vlookup vs Excel PivotTable?

AspectExcel VlookupExcel PivotTable
Primary FunctionLookup and retrieve data from a table based on a keySummarize, analyze, and organize large data sets
UsageData retrieval and matchingData aggregation and reporting
ComplexityModerate; requires understanding of formulasHigh; involves data structuring and drag-and-drop interface
Common inData analysis, financial modelingReporting, dashboards, data summaries

Excel Vlookup is used to find specific data within a table based on a matching value, making it ideal for data retrieval tasks. In contrast, Excel PivotTable helps users analyze and summarize large datasets quickly, providing insights through dynamic reports. Both tools are essential in data analysis but serve different purposes: Vlookup for precise data lookup and PivotTables for data summarization and visualization.

What is VLOOKUP in Excel and how is it used?

VLOOKUP is a function in Excel that allows users to search for a value in the first column of a table and return a related value from another column in the same row. It's commonly used to quickly find and retrieve information from large datasets. To use VLOOKUP, you specify the value to search for, the range of data, the column number of the value to return, and whether you want an exact or approximate match. This makes it a powerful tool for data analysis, reporting, and managing spreadsheets efficiently.
